Explore Beaches and Waterfront Activities
One of the highlights of things to do in Lake Tahoe with kids is exploring its pristine beaches. Spend a day building sandcastles at Incline Village West Shore, or enjoy swimming and paddleboarding at Sand Harbor Beach. Many beaches have shallow waters perfect for young swimmers and offer picnic areas, making them ideal spots for family fun.
Go on Easy Nature Hikes
Lake Tahoe is dotted with family-friendly trails that offer scenic views and educational experiences. For an easy hike, try the Rabe Meadow Loop or the Lake Tahoe Dam Trail. These paths are stroller-friendly and provide opportunities for kids to learn about local flora and fauna while enjoying fresh mountain air.
Take a Scenic Gondola Ride
A must-do in things to do in Lake Tahoe with kids is riding the Heavenly Mountain Gondola. The ride provides stunning panoramic views of Lake Tahoe and the surrounding mountains. Kids will love the thrill of the ride, and there are often interactive activities or mini-play areas at the top station.
Enjoy Water Sports and Boat Tours
Lake Tahoe is renowned for its crystal-clear waters. Consider renting kayaks, paddleboards, or taking a boat tour suitable for children. Many companies offer family-friendly options that provide safety equipment and briefings, making water adventures accessible and fun for kids.
Visit Kid-Friendly Attractions
- KidZone Museum in Truckee: An interactive play space where children can indulge in art, science, and imaginative play.
- Sugar Pine Point State Park: Offers educational programs and a historic estate for a glimpse into Tahoe’s history.
- UNR Lake Tahoe Science Center: Provides engaging exhibits and hands-on activities about the lake’s ecology.
Go Biking on Family-Friendly Trails
Biking is a fantastic way to explore Lake Tahoe with kids. The North Tahoe Bike Trail System and the Truckee River Legacy Trail are perfect for families, offering flat terrains and scenic views. Bike rentals are available in most towns, ensuring an easy and convenient adventure.
Enjoy Winter Activities (Seasonal)
If visiting during winter, things to do in Lake Tahoe with kids include snowshoeing, sledding, and learning to ski or snowboard. Resorts like Northstar and Squaw Valley offer lessons and designated kid zones, making winter sports accessible for children.
Plan a Camping Adventure
For families who love outdoor camping, Lake Tahoe provides numerous campgrounds with amenities suitable for kids. Camping offers a chance to connect with nature, tell stories around the campfire, and enjoy star-gazing in one of California’s most beautiful settings.
